About Grand Junction Metro Treatment Center

New Season Grand Junction Metro Treatment Center is part of a large organization providing outpatient addiction treatment. Located in Grand Junction, Colorado, this facility focuses on treating opioid use disorder in adults. You’ll engage in an intensive outpatient program and medication assisted treatment while enrolled. Treatment will include comprehensive medical evaluation and medically assisted detox when needed.

During treatment you’ll be involved with individual and group counseling and recovery education. Family support will be a big part of treatment. The intensive outpatient program is three days per week for three hours. You can expect treatment to last for a minimum of six weeks. Counseling will focus on skill building and addressing barriers to recovery. This program will give you a sober support system. Medications like methadone, buprenorphine, and suboxone are used to treat withdrawal symptoms. These medications will also reduce drug cravings and help sustain long term recovery.

Assertive Community Treatment (ACT)

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) is an integrative, community-based care strategy designed to address the needs of persons with severe and/or complex mental illness or behavioral disorders. ACT is typically provided by a multidisciplinary team of medical and mental health care providers, social workers, therapists, and other specialists, including addiction recovery professionals. These services are frequently provided in the home and community to clients in crisis, those who are clinically unstable, and those who are unable or unwilling to travel to a hospital or clinic for in-person treatment.
